| 质粒名称: | pET42b-BE3 |
|---|---|
| 出品公司: | addgene |
| 目录编号: | 87437 |
| 存储实验室: | David Liu |
|
载体骨架基本信息 |
|
| 载体名称: | pET_42b |
| 空载体大小: | 4083 bp |
| 完整质粒大小: | 10375bp |
| 载体类型: | 细菌细胞表达 |
| 载体抗性: | 卡那霉素 |
| 生长温度: | 37 ℃ |
| 宿主菌: | DH5a |
| 拷贝数: | 低拷贝 |
|
插入基因信息 |
|
| 插入基因名称: | BE3/GGS-His6-rAPOBEC1-XTEN-nCas9-GGS-UGI-GGS-NLS |
| 物种来源: | H. sapiens (human), R. norvegicus (rat); Bacillus phage PBS2 |
| 启动子: | T7 |
| 标签/融合蛋白: | His6 (N terminal on insert) |
| 克隆方法: | 限制性内切酶 |
| 5’测序引物 | TAATACGACTCACTATAGGG |
| 3’测序引物 | GCTAGTTATTGCTCAGCGG |
|
文献引用方法 |
|
| 材料和方法部分: | pET42b-BE3 was a gift from David Liu (Addgene plasmid # 87437 ; http://n2t.net/addgene:87437 ; RRID:Addgene_87437) |
| 参考文献部分: | Improving the DNA specificity and applicability of base editing through protein engineering and protein delivery. Rees HA, Komor AC, Yeh WH, Caetano-Lopes J, Warman M, Edge ASB, Liu DR. Nat Commun. 2017 Jun 6;8:15790. doi: 10.1038/ncomms15790. 10.1038/ncomms15790 PubMed 28585549 |
